Я делаю утилиту Python с красивым супом, у сайта, который я сканирую, есть контейнер с заголовком, ссылкой и текстом, 28, текст в теге <p>
, моя проблема в том, что я могу сканировать все данные, но некоторые <p>
теги не имеют текста, поэтому я получаю сообщение об ошибке "AttributeError: 'NoneType' object has no attribute 'text'"
мой код:
containers = page_soup.findAll("div", {"class":"item-container"})
for contain in containers:
title = contain.div.a.h3.text
print("title: "+title)
link = contain.div.a["href"]
print("source: "+link)
des = contain.div.p.text
print("Description: "+des)
он печатает 5 раз <p>
текст тега, поскольку не все теги <p>
имеют текст, ноэто дает мне ошибку, как решить эту проблему?